    Inferring User Personality from Twitter

    Full text link
    Personality affects how a person behaves when interacting with people and computer systems. It can determine one’s needs and preferences in different contexts, which is especially useful for adaptive and recommender systems. Personality questionnaires are widely used to acquire information about user personality. However, filling in them can be tedious. Analyzing the user interactions can be another way of obtaining that information. Since personality has an impact on the way a person interacts with others, and social networks are widely used for this purpose, information about user interactions through social networks can give a clue about their personality. In this paper, we present a system able to obtain data about user interactions in Twitter and analyze them in order to infer user personality.     Serious Games for Training Myoelectric Prostheses through Multi-Contact Devices

    Full text link
    In the medical context, designing and developing myoelectric prostheses has made it possible for patients to regain mobility lost due to amputations; however, their use requires intensive training. Serious games through multi-touch devices can serve as a complement to the activities carried out during face-to-face sessions with occupational therapists and physiotherapists, as a useful resource to engage patients, especially children, and make them enjoy training. In this paper, we describe our work to support the training of myoelectric prostheses through digital serious games. Firstly, we studied the needs of children with myoelectric prostheses and the way they perform rehabilitation. Secondly, we designed specific games to support training accordingly. Thirdly, we developed a system able to generate variations of these games dynamically, adapting the elements at each round to the needs and progress of each child. The interfaces are simple, friendly, and based on tablets to favor autonomy. Finally, we assessed the potential of the use of these games for rehabilitation.     The Role of Vascular Lesions in Diabetes Across a Spectrum of Clinical Kidney Disease

    Get PDF
    Albuminuria; Diabetes; HistologyAlbuminuria; Diabetes; HistologíaAlbuminúria; Diabetis; HistologiaIntroduction The clinical-histologic correlation in diabetic nephropathy is not completely known. Methods We analyzed nephrectomy specimens from 90 patients with diabetes and diverse degrees of proteinuria and glomerular filtration rate (GFR). Results Thirty-six (40%) subjects had normoalbuminuria, 33 (37%) microalbuminuria, and 21 (23%) non-nephrotic proteinuria. Mean estimated GFR (eGFR) was 65±23 (40% 10% to 20% of the sample. Moderate hyalinosis and arteriolar sclerosis were observed in 80% to 100% of cases with normoalbuminuria, microalbuminuria, proteinuria, as well as in class I, II, or III. Conclusions Weak correspondence between analytical parameters and kidney histology was found. Thus, disease may progress undetected from the early clinical stages of the disease.     Tratamiento farmacológico de Covid-19 en pediatría: Comité de Farmacovigilancia del Hospital General de Niños Pedro de Elizalde

    Get PDF
    Introducción: El grupo que conforma el Comité de Farmacovigilancia del Hospital General de Niños Pedro de Elizalde realizó una revisión de la literatura publicada acerca de los tratamientos farmacológicos disponibles para la infección por SARS-CoV-2 en pediatría, con el propósito de informar acerca de sus mecanismos de acción, dosis, efectos adversos, interacciones medicamentosas y presentación en el mercado argentino. Materiales y Métodos: Se realizó una búsqueda en bases de datos bibliográficas y en Agencias Nacionales e Internacionales reguladoras de alimentos y medicamentos. Se utilizaron como criterios de inclusión textos en inglés y/o español, con acceso al texto completo, publicados hasta junio de 2020. Resultados: No existe evidencia actual que permita recomendar un tratamiento farmacológico determinado en la población pediátrica con infección por SARS-CoV-2, de acuerdo con las diferentes fuentes bibliográficas consultadas.     RICORS2040 : The need for collaborative research in chronic kidney disease

    Get PDF
    Chronic kidney disease (CKD) is a silent and poorly known killer. The current concept of CKD is relatively young and uptake by the public, physicians and health authorities is not widespread. Physicians still confuse CKD with chronic kidney insufficiency or failure. For the wider public and health authorities, CKD evokes kidney replacement therapy (KRT). In Spain, the prevalence of KRT is 0.13%. Thus health authorities may consider CKD a non-issue: very few persons eventually need KRT and, for those in whom kidneys fail, the problem is 'solved' by dialysis or kidney transplantation. However, KRT is the tip of the iceberg in the burden of CKD. The main burden of CKD is accelerated ageing and premature death. The cut-off points for kidney function and kidney damage indexes that define CKD also mark an increased risk for all-cause premature death. CKD is the most prevalent risk factor for lethal coronavirus disease 2019 (COVID-19) and the factor that most increases the risk of death in COVID-19, after old age. Men and women undergoing KRT still have an annual mortality that is 10- to 100-fold higher than similar-age peers, and life expectancy is shortened by ~40 years for young persons on dialysis and by 15 years for young persons with a functioning kidney graft. CKD is expected to become the fifth greatest global cause of death by 2040 and the second greatest cause of death in Spain before the end of the century, a time when one in four Spaniards will have CKD. However, by 2022, CKD will become the only top-15 global predicted cause of death that is not supported by a dedicated well-funded Centres for Biomedical Research (CIBER) network structure in Spain. Realizing the underestimation of the CKD burden of disease by health authorities, the Decade of the Kidney initiative for 2020-2030 was launched by the American Association of Kidney Patients and the European Kidney Health Alliance. Leading Spanish kidney researchers grouped in the kidney collaborative research network Red de Investigación Renal have now applied for the Redes de Investigación Cooperativa Orientadas a Resultados en Salud (RICORS) call for collaborative research in Spain with the support of the Spanish Society of Nephrology, Federación Nacional de Asociaciones para la Lucha Contra las Enfermedades del Riñón and ONT: RICORS2040 aims to prevent the dire predictions for the global 2040 burden of CKD from becoming true

    COMPORTAMIENTO DE LOSAS APOYADAS EN SUELO UTILIZANDO CONCRETO REFORZADO CON FIBRAS METÁLICAS

    No full text
    En este documento se analiza el comportamiento del concreto reforzado con fibras metálicas (SFRC) y se presentan los resultados de diferentes metodologías de diseño para losas apoyadas en el suelo. Específicamente, se estudiaron las metodologías de los códigos de diseño ACI 360R-06 (ACI, 2006) y TR34 (The Concrete Society, 2003) con el fin de reconocer los beneficios que conlleva la utilización del SFRC y poder obtener una mayor eficiencia en su uso.La investigación experimental desarrollada se basó en obtener el parámetro Re,3, a partir de una resistencia de concreto y un tipo de fibra específicos con el objetivo de comprobar el comportamiento mecánico del SFRC y compararlo contra los datos de las especificaciones técnicas utilizadas

    Aphrodisiac activity of Phlegmariurus saururus in copulating and noncopulating male rats

    No full text
    Background Phlegmariurus saururus is popularly known in Argentina as aphrodisiac. For this reason, it was previously investigated and determined that the decoction of this plant elicits pro-ejaculatory activity and increases the ejaculatory potency in the Fictive Ejaculation Model. Hypothesis/Purpose the decoction of P. saururus facilitates sexual behavior in sexually experienced male rat and induces copulatory behavior in non-copulating male rats. Methods The extraction method (decoction) was validated through Selectivity, Accuracy and Precision, by identification of the majority alkaloids, expressed as sauroxine. Male (sexually experienced and noncopulating) and female (receptive) Wistar rats were used to determine sexual behavior. Sildenafil was used as positive control. The following variables were evaluated: Mount Latency, Intromission Latency, Ejaculation Latency, Post Ejaculatory Interval, as well as the Mounts and Intromissions Number. Results In sexually experienced male rats, P. saururus decoction stimulates sexual arousal and facilitates sexual execution. In noncopulating male rats, this decoction induces copulation with behavioral characteristics similar to sexually experienced animals.
